Output db80fec50994438d80daa5d8aa87ccabc6c2530386d1bfb2d131f2537f8abf61:0

value
384851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687ab0a0a7e207a5e7c272e4552571129d3287fd OP_EQUAL
address
3BDTB99tJ14Ujja6KkqZYPXKx83h96D4Hd
transaction
db80fec50994438d80daa5d8aa87ccabc6c2530386d1bfb2d131f2537f8abf61
spent
true